Job Description

Overview

Bowhead seeks a VTC Administrator to support our customer on the PICRD II contract in Colorado Springs, CO.

Responsibilities

• Provide VTC/AV hardware support, setup, and troubleshooting for various systems (NIPRNET, SIPRNET, COE JWICS, GWAN, GOLD).
• Plan, coordinate, facilitate VTCs for Unclassified, Classified, and JWICS networks.
• Determine equipment and setup requirements, perform technical review of requests, and ensure compliance with operational guidance.
• Schedule VTCs, establish accounts with DISA and JWICS, and coordinate with customers and facilitators. Provide customer service and technical assistance, monitor and support equipment performance during events.
• Ensure sufficient lead time to establish connections to VTC sites and inform Action Officer where presentations are stored for later use.
• Coordinate with remote site participants to enable smooth global connection.
• Troubleshoot connection issues, to include external connections, and maintain extensive knowledge of Multi-Point Conferencing Units (MCU) resources and limitations.
• Maintain direct in-person support for priority presentations and briefings and document deficiencies and escalate trouble tickets as necessary.
• Maintain up-to-date knowledge on current VTC/AV technologies. Maintain a baseline of VTC capabilities, provide preventive maintenance inspections (PMIs).
• Track and manage VTC/AV equipment, update control system and touch panel files, and ensure firmware updates are applied.

Qualifications

• A BS degree in Information Technology, Cybersecurity, Data Science, Information Systems, or Computer Science preferred.
• Minimum of 6 years advanced experience in engineering and installing VTC/AV systems and installing VTC/AV systems, knowledge of how to upload Crestron and AMX control programing and knowledge, and DSP audio installation for VTC/AV system.
• Excellent customer service skills including customer relationships, responsiveness, and timely resolution of customer issues, and the ability to problem-solve creatively in time-sensitive situations.
• Core and Additional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ities Tasks (KSATs) defined in the DoD Cyber Workforce Framework for Work Role 411.
• Experience supporting and maintaining VTC/AV equipment and scheduling on the NIPRNET, SIPRNET, COE JWICS, GWAN, and GOLD networks.
• Experience engineering and installing VTC/AV systems.
• Sec+ certification.

CERTIFICATION REQUIREMENTS:
• Comp TIA Security + is required.

• Crestron Programmer Certification, Crestron Technician Certification, Extron Control Professional Certification, Extron Network AV Specialist, Extron Authorized Programmer Certification, and Thinklogical Technology 300 are highly preferred.

• Python 3.x proficiency is highly preferred.

SECURITY CLEARANCE REQUIRED: Must currently hold a Top Secret security clearance with SCI eligibility.
